    Modifying View Titles

    Hi,
    I'm still coming to terms with Revit (after switching from ADT), and generally I love it. It's so much more intuitive and closer to the way you 'want' to work rather than how it will 'let' you work.

    A few things are give me some headaches at present...

    The attached image illustrates:

    the section on the right - how can I get the text to appear on a single line? I don't seem to have any control over this, and it would be nice to be able to change view titles after they are assigned.

    Re: Modifying View Titles

    05-18-2004 09:02 AM in reply to: gmak
    Open the viewtitle family and make the label for view name longer. The text wraps based on the size of the text boundary in the family.     Re: Modifying View Titles

    05-18-2004 09:18 AM in reply to: gmak
    Once done adjusting viewtitle family do not forget to load it into project so your changes propagate there.
